ABC rebrands 44 regional stations

Staff Writer

ABC Radio has begun a rollout of branding updates for its 44 regional bureaux.

The branding will be seen on all broadcast platforms, social media, apps, websites and third-party platforms.

It follows a rebrand of ABC’s Capital City stations from two years ago.

“Audiences are increasingly accessing content via digital platforms, and a consistent identity across broadcast, online and mobile will allow audience to identify us quickly, easily and intuitively on the device of their choice,” said a spokesperson for the ABC.

“As part of this week’s roll out, ten regional stations are dropping call signs from their names and two station are undergoing a significant name change to better identify their local region.”

No programming will change as a part of the rebranding.

The following stations will rebrand:

  • 1233 ABC Newcastle > ABC Newcastle
  • 97.3 ABC Illawarra > ABC Illawarra
  • ABC Western Victoria > ABC Wimmera
  • 107.9 ABC Ballarat > ABC Ballarat
  • 91.7 ABC Gold Coast > ABC Gold Coast
  • 90.3 ABC Sunshine Coast > ABC Sunshine Coast
  • 1062 ABC Riverland > ABC Riverland
  • 639 ABC North & West SA > ABC North & West
  • 1485 ABC Eyre Peninsula and West Coast > ABC Eyre Peninsula
  • 999 ABC Broken Hill > ABC Broken Hill
  • ABC North West WA > ABC Pilbara
